Job Summary: Six Flags White Water is looking for a qualified Water Park Mechanic. This position is responsible for the inspection, repair and upkeep of various water park attractions, fiberglass ride components and other water attractions at Six Flags White Water.

 

STATUS: Full Time Hourly, Non-Exempt. 

Responsibilities

  • Inspect water park rides, amusement park attractions and notifying management of any and all hazards that may endanger guests or employees.
  • Perform the ride inspection and maintenance programs in accordance with the standards set by Six Flags, Ride Manufacturers, ASTM and the State of Georgia.
  • Maintain and repair water park attractions, swimming pools, and park facilities.
  • Visually and physically inspect ride components such as water slides, plumbing systems, swimming pools, interactive play features, pumps/motors, attraction support structures and chemical control systems.
  • Visually and physically inspect ride components such as upholstery, boats, floatation devices and vehicle body components.
  • Basic mechanical repairs of ride vehicle components.
  • Inspect and repair fiberglass waterslides.
  • Maintain Six Flags Water Quality program for Six Flags White Water.
  • Respond to work orders and conduct repairs as required to maintain safe park operation.
  • Adhere to park policies and procedures.
  • Other duties as assigned

Pay Range: $30.00 - $40.00/hr. (depending on level of experience). Work in excess of 40 hours per week is paid at 1.5x standard pay rate. This position is covered by a Collective Bargaining Agreement.

Qualifications

  • Basic mechanical skills.
  • Experience in FRP fabrication/repair, polyester, gelcoat, and epoxy lamination.
  • Ability to meet deadlines.
  • Ability to professionally interact with other shops and various departments.
  • Must be able to troubleshoot clearly, calmly and safely in the presence of guests, co-workers and park management.
  • Ability to write, speak and comprehend English.
  • Able to meet the physical demands of the job including lifting, bending, standing for long periods of time, climbing, and working at heights up to 200 ft.
  • Knowledge of OSHA rules and regulations.
  • Ability to work outside in any weather conditions, nights, weekends and holidays.
  • Valid Drivers’ License and clean DMV report.
  • Must be able to pass a Certified Pool Operator (CPO) course within 12 months of hire date or maintain a current license.
  • Employees are required to supply their own hand tools.
